Can I Use My Cashapp Card at an ATM?
Yes, You can use your Cashapp Card at an ATM.
Detailed steps on how to use your Cash App Card at an ATM:
1. Locate an ATM: Find a nearby ATM that accepts Visa or Mastercard debit cards. You can usually identify these ATMs by looking for the Visa or Mastercard logos displayed on the machine.
2. Insert Card: Insert your Cash App Card into the ATM’s card slot. Make sure the side with the chip is facing up or follow the on-screen instructions if provided
3. Enter Your PIN: The ATM will prompt you to enter your Personal Identification Number (PIN). This is the four-digit code you set up when you activated your Cash App Card. Carefully enter your PIN using the keypad provided.
4. Choose a Transaction Type: Most ATMs offer a range of options. Select “Withdrawal” or “Cash Withdrawal” to initiate the process of withdrawing money from your Cash App account.

Let’s explore the relationship between the Cash App Card and ATMs (Automated Teller Machines):Cash App Card and ATM Usage:
The Cash App Card is a physical debit card that is linked to a user’s Cash App account. It provides users with the convenience of accessing their Cash App account funds for various financial activities, including ATM withdrawals. Here’s how the relationship between the Cash App Card and ATMs works:
1. ATM Withdrawals:
The Cash App Card allows users to withdraw cash from ATMs that accept Visa debit cards. When using the card at an ATM, users can follow these steps:
(1)Insert or swipe the Cash App Card in the ATM’s card slot.
(2) Follow the on-screen instructions to enter the card’s Personal Identification Number (PIN).
(3) Select the amount of cash to withdraw from the available options.
(4) Complete the transaction, and the requested cash will be dispensed from the ATM.
2. ATM Networks:
The Cash App Card is generally accepted at ATMs that are part of major networks, such as the Visa, Plus, or Star networks. Users can look for the Visa logo on ATMs to ensure compatibility with their Cash App Card.
3. ATM Withdrawal Fees:
While Cash App itself may not charge ATM withdrawal fees, some ATMs may impose their own fees for using their machines. It’s important for users to be aware of these potential fees before making withdrawals to avoid surprises.
4. Daily ATM Withdrawal Limits:
Cash App Card users should be aware of the daily ATM withdrawal limit set by Cash App. This limit restricts the maximum amount that can be withdrawn from ATMs within a 24-hour period. Users can check the Cash App app or website to find information about their specific withdrawal limit.
5. Cash App App Notifications:
Users receive real-time notifications on their Cash App app when an ATM withdrawal is made using their Cash App Card. These notifications help users keep track of their account activity and maintain security awareness.
